Studying Online at Fullerton College
Online coursework is an option at Fullerton College. Of 19,521 students, 6,379 (33%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 6,968 (36%) took at least some classes online.

Vehicle Maintenance & Repair Associate’s Program at Fullerton College
Of the 8 associate’s vehicle maintenance & repair degrees awarded at Fullerton College, 12% were women (1) and 88% were men (7).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Vehicle Maintenance & Repair associate’s degree recipients at Fullerton College.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 2 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 5 |
| Asian | 1 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 75% of Vehicle Maintenance & Repair associate’s degree recipients at Fullerton College, higher than the national average of 48%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
